Heroin is an extremely powerful and highly addictive drug that has the potential to inflict grievous harm on individuals who abuse it. A member of the opioid family, heroin initially creates an intense rush of euphoria when abused, along with a decrease in blood pressure and respiration. Addiction, or heroin use disorder, can occur quickly and is accompanied by a need for increasingly larger or more potent doses, which raises the risk of overdose. When a person with heroin use disorder attempts to stop abusing the drug, he or she will likely experience a series of distressing physical and psychological symptoms within a few hours. These withdrawal symptoms can make it virtually impossible for a person to end his or her dependence upon heroin without effective treatment from a reputable addiction rehab center.

How Do I Find Help for a Heroin Addiction in Peterborough, NH?

Heroin rehab programs provide effective treatment and support for people addicted to heroin. Comprehensive heroin rehab is offered in a number of treatment settings, including both inpatient and outpatient. Many rehabs for heroin or other opioid drugs include a detox program at the start of treatment. Then the patient receives a combination of therapeutic interventions, such as individual therapy, group counseling, family therapy, peer support groups, and more, to help rectify drug-using behaviors and avoid relapse.

Rehab Therapy in Peterborough, NH

After you complete detox, you will enter into addiction therapy. There are many different options for therapy at heroin rehab facilities. Most rehab centers provide both individual and group therapy, along with education about addiction. Some facilities will also incorporate family therapy sessions into the treatment process, or provde psychiatric treatment if the individual has an underlying mental health disorder.

Aftercare and Ongoing Support in Peterborough, NH

Because every recovery process is as different as the person recovering, heroin rehab centers will carefully plan for ongoing care once the initial treatment duration has ended. To do so, many treatment programs will offer their own aftercare programs or will go to great lengths to plan for or arrange extended treatment or aftercare for all treatment alumni.

People in recovery tend to do best when they have a plan in place for when they check out. During the treatment process, trained counselors will work with you to develop an aftercare plan, which can include outpatient treatment, private therapy, 12-step meetings, long-term residential treatment, and sober-living housing.

Rehab Near or Away From Home in Peterborough, NH

Whether you should travel or check in to a heroin rehab center that is near you is a personal choice. If there are a lot of family members and sober supports within the community, staying close may be a better choice.

Some individuals find that traveling helps them start the new path of recovery and avoid outside stressors or triggers. The most important aspect is that the individual seeking treatment feels sufficiently safe and comfortable to focus on treating the addiction.

Heroin Withdrawal Symptoms

Withdrawal symptoms begin between 4 and 24 hours after the last dose of heroin. The severity and duration of withdrawal may depend on how long the individual used heroin, as well as the amount and method of heroin use.

Heroin withdrawal symptoms are described as a severe case of the flu, and typically include:

  • Mood changes, like agitation and anxiety;
  • Increased body secretions (runny nose, teary eyes, and sweaty skin);
  • Stomach problems (nausea, vomiting, cramping, diarrhea, and loss of appetite);
  • Muscle problems (aches, twitching, shivering);
  • Sneezing;
  • Goosebumps;
  • Yawning

What are the long-term effects of heroin abuse in Peterborough, NH?

Prolonged use of heroin has devastating physical effects. Chronic users may develop liver disease, collapsed veins, abscesses and infections. They may experience pulmonary diseases such as pneumonia. Because heroin sold on the street is not pure, it may contain additives that can clog vessels in the brain, lungs, kidneys or liver. If this complication does not result in death, it can cause infection. It destroys the addict both physically and emotionally if used for a long enough period of time. Dangers of Heroin Abuse and Addiction

Heroin addiction and abuse is the epidemic of our generation and affects people of all race, background, and class. Opiate related deaths are the leading cause of accidental deaths in the United States. The death toll per year of opiate overdoses resulting in death has recently taken the lead to vehicular collisions. Every 19 minutes someone is losing their life to this deadly drug.

Overdose and death are not the only worries for those using heroin. Injecting the drug puts users at high risks of contracting diseases through blood and bodily fluids. HIV and hepatitis C are among the common diseases we see transmitted through sharing needles.
